The Arts Alliance of Yamhill County is excited to share the AAYC Member Directory, a new feature of the AAYC Hub designed to help our arts community become more visible, connected, and accessible.
The directory gives members a place to share who they are, what they do, and how the community can connect with them. Whether you are an artist, gallery, arts business, creative organization, or business that supports the arts, your profile helps tell the story of our local creative community.

Members can set up and manage their own profiles directly in the AAYC Hub. Your profile may include your name or business name, photo or logo, artist statement or business description, contact information, website, social media links, areas of focus, and other details that help people understand your work.
A complete profile helps you be seen and known.
For artists, the directory creates a place to share your creative work, describe your practice, and help people discover what you offer. It can help connect you with potential buyers, collaborators, galleries, teaching opportunities, and community members who want to support local artists.

For galleries, the directory helps increase visibility for your space, your exhibitions, and your role in supporting artists and the broader arts ecosystem. It gives community members and visitors another way to discover where art is being shown and experienced in Yamhill County.

For business members, the directory highlights your support of the arts and your connection to the creative life of our community. Businesses that support the arts help strengthen the local economy, build community identity, and show that creativity matters here.
The directory is also valuable for the public. It gives residents, visitors, partners, and organizations a central place to discover local artists, galleries, creative businesses, and arts supporters. Instead of information being scattered across many places, the directory helps bring our arts community together in one searchable resource.
Members also control their own visibility. You can choose what information to share, update your profile as your work changes, and keep your information current over time. This makes the directory more useful, more accurate, and more sustainable for everyone.
